What is Artificial Intelligence?
Artificial intelligence refers to machines that can perform tasks that normally require human intelligence. This includes learning, reasoning, problem solving and, in some cases, understanding natural language. Think of AI as a companion that never tires and is always ready to help you.
Types of Artificial Intelligence
Weak AI vs. Strong AI
AI is divided into two categories: weak AI and strong AI. Weak AI refers to systems designed to perform specific tasks, such as a vacuuming robot. Strong AI, on the other hand, is more complex. This form of AI could understand and reason like a human being. Although we are still far from achieving strong AI, weak AI is very present in our lives.
Machine Learning
Machine learning is a crucial part of AI. It is a method in which machines learn from data and improve their performance over time. Imagine you have a dog that learns to fetch the ball every time you do it. That's similar to how machine learning works; The machine improves with practice.
Practical Applications of AI
Virtual Assistants
Virtual assistants like Siri and Alexa are clear examples of AI in action. They can answer questions, remind you of your appointments, and even play music. Its ability to understand and process human language is astonishing and shows the potential of artificial intelligence.
Diagnosis in Medicine
AI is also changing medicine. Some machines can analyze medical images and help doctors detect diseases like cancer before a human eye can. This means we could have faster and more accurate diagnoses thanks to AI.
Autonomous Vehicles
Self-driving cars are another exciting example. These machines use AI to navigate streets, recognize signs, and avoid obstacles. Imagine relaxing while the car takes you to your destination. That is the future of mobility.
Challenges and Ethical Considerations
Although artificial intelligence offers many advantages, there are also challenges. Data privacy is one of the biggest concerns. We all want our data to be secure, but it is often collected without us realizing it.
Another challenge is biases in AI. If the training data is biased, the AI will be too. This can affect important decisions, such as who receives a loan or a job offer.
